Hillside Applied Behavior Analysis is seeking a dedicated BCBA to provide in-home and community-based services to children with autism.


The role includes managing a caseload of clients, conducting assessments, developing treatment plans, supervising Behavior Technicians, training caregivers, and monitoring client progress.


Requirements:

  1. Active BCBA certification
  2. New York LBA license or eligibility
  3. Relevant master’s degree
  4. Pediatric autism experience
  5. Reliable transportation
  6. Strong clinical and communication skills


Benefits include flexible scheduling, a 401(k), paid sick days, and direct access to leadership.
